What is the best way to ripen strawberries after picking?
To ripen strawberries after picking, it’s essential to understand that strawberries do not continue to ripen in the same way as some other fruits, such as bananas or avocados. Instead, strawberries are typically picked when they are fully ripe, as they will not continue to produce more sugar or soften significantly after being harvested. However, if you have picked strawberries that are not yet fully ripe, you can try placing them in a paper bag with an apple or banana, as these fruits emit ethylene gas, which can help stimulate the ripening process.
It’s crucial to note that the effectiveness of this method may vary, and it’s not a guarantee that the strawberries will ripen to the same extent as they would have on the plant. How long do strawberries last after picking, and what factors affect their shelf life?
The shelf life of strawberries after picking can vary depending on several factors, such as the variety, storage conditions, and handling practices. Generally, strawberries can last for 1-3 days at room temperature and up to 5-7 days when stored in the refrigerator. However, some strawberry varieties, such as those bred for longer shelf life, can last up to 10-14 days when stored properly.
Factors that can affect the shelf life of strawberries include temperature, humidity, handling practices, and storage conditions. For example, strawberries that are exposed to high temperatures, moisture, or physical damage can spoil more quickly. Additionally, strawberries that are not stored properly, such as being crowded or exposed to air, can also develop mold or become overripe more quickly. To maximize the shelf life of strawberries, it’s essential to store them in a cool, dry place, handle them gently, and maintain proper storage conditions.

How do I know if strawberries are ripe and ready to eat, and what are the signs of overripe strawberries?
To determine if strawberries are ripe and ready to eat, you can look for several signs, such as their color, texture, and aroma. Ripe strawberries are typically bright red, plump, and firm to the touch, with a sweet and slightly tart aroma. You can also gently squeeze the strawberry to check its texture; ripe strawberries should be slightly soft to the touch but still firm enough to hold their shape.
Overripe strawberries, on the other hand, can be identified by their soft, mushy texture, and their color may be more pale or develop brown spots. Overripe strawberries may also have a sour or unpleasant aroma and can be more prone to mold and spoilage. If you notice any signs of overripe strawberries, it’s best to use them immediately or discard them to prevent spoilage. Additionally, you can also check the stem end of the strawberry; if it comes off easily, the strawberry is likely ripe and ready to eat.
